10 Tree-mendous Puns That Will Make You Root With Laughter

  1. Why don’t trees ever feel lonely? Because they’re always branching out to make new friends! Trees constantly grow new limbs, reaching toward the sky and creating connections with their surroundings.
  2. What did the tree wear to the pool party? Swim trunks! This classic play on words works perfectly since tree trunks are the main supporting structure of these magnificent plants.
  3. What’s a tree’s favorite dating app? Timber! While the app might actually be called Tinder, this forestry-themed wordplay creates a hilarious connection to the lumberjack’s cry.
  4. How do trees access the internet? They log in! This clever double meaning references both computer login processes and the logs created when trees are cut down.
  5. Why was the tree so good at math? It had strong roots in algebra! Trees develop extensive root systems that provide stability, just like a solid foundation in mathematics.
  6. What did the oak say to the maple during autumn? “You’re really starting to show your true colors!” Maple trees are famous for their vibrant red foliage during fall, creating this perfect seasonal pun.
  7. Why don’t trees like riddles? Because they’re too stumped! When trees are cut down, they leave stumps behind, creating this clever wordplay about being confused or puzzled.
  8. What kind of tree fits in your hand? A palm tree! This geographical pun works on multiple levels, connecting the tropical palm tree with the palm of your hand.
  9. How do trees get online? They use the industry wide wood! This play on the “industry wide web” incorporates trees’ primary material into internet terminology.
  10. What did the tree say after a long day? “I’m absolutely bushed!” Trees are often called bushes when they’re smaller, making this expression of exhaustion particularly fitting for our leafy friends.

Leaf It To The Classics: Traditional Tree Puns

69bdd83b d31f 403b b52a 475311ebed13:0VVBy9Qr0rICnoUhh7kgckDRy YIOwZ0

Traditional tree puns have stood the test of time, delighting nature enthusiasts and wordplay aficionados alike. These classic jokes play on tree components and their natural behaviors in clever ways.

  • What do you get hanging from apple trees? Sore arms!
  • Why did the tree go to school? To improve its trunk!
  • What type of tree fits in your hand? A palm tree!
  • Why do trees go to the dentist? They need a root canal!
  • How do trees access the internet? They log in!

How To Craft Your Own Unbeleafable Tree Puns

69bdd83b d31f 403b b52a 475311ebed13:sZ8945 AqMD KQyWDJEOgFJNFXDYOEP6

Use Tree-Related Words

Creating your own tree puns starts with incorporating tree-exact terminology into everyday phrases. Words like “leaf,” “branch,” “root,” “bark,” and “trunk” serve as perfect foundations for clever wordplay. Try replacing similar-sounding words in common expressions with these tree terms to instantly create a pun. For example, transform “believe” into “be-leaf” or turn “remarkable” into “re-markable” when discussing tree rings.

Play with Homophones

Homophones offer fertile soil for growing exceptional tree puns. Words that sound similar to tree-related terms can create delightful double meanings in your conversations. Replace “not” with “knot,” “pine” (the emotion) with “pine” (the tree), or “would” with “wood” to create puns that make people smile. These sound-alike substitutions help your jokes take root and branch out in unexpected ways.

Make Common Phrases Tree-Themed

Transforming everyday expressions into arboreal masterpieces creates instantly recognizable yet surprising puns. Instead of saying someone is “expanding their horizons,” mention they’re “branching out” into new territories. Replace “leave your worries behind” with “leaf your worries behind” for an instant mood lifter. Common phrases provide the perfect structure to graft your tree terminology onto, resulting in puns that resonate with listeners.

Explore Seasonal and Holiday Themes

Seasonal events offer excellent opportunities for themed tree puns that feel timely and relevant. Arbor Day celebrations practically beg for comments about “trunk-giving” or how “tree-mendous” the holiday feels. Christmas tree jokes about “pines and needles” connect instantly with holiday audiences. Autumn provides countless chances to discuss how trees are “turning over a new leaf” or having “un-be-leaf-able” color displays.

Incorporate Exact Tree Types

Different tree species unlock specialized pun potential that shows botanical knowledge while delivering laughs. Ask if someone is “pining” for something when discussing evergreens. Mention how you’re “oak-ay” when near an oak tree. Cherry trees let you discuss situations that are “cherry exciting,” while maple trees provide opportunities to comment on “sap-py” emotional moments. Exact tree references demonstrate both creativity and nature awareness in your wordplay.
